VOC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

19 of the 4,888 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in VOC Energy (VOC)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$1.89M — up 50% from $1.26M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of VOC and 1 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 3 trimmed existing stakes and 7 added.

The largest buyer was Creative Planning, adding an estimated $45.2K.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$82K sold.
